Before the new season begins and we forget what happened in Brazil, maybe it's time to have a look at the English game. It is now nearly half a century since England won the World Cup (England will not bid for World Cup until Fifa reforms – Dyke, 23 July). There are no plans to change the structure of football in England, as did Germany 10 years ago, when they lost badly. Instead of a national team we've got the Premier League. It's a lousy bargain.
Only five clubs have ever won the Premier League. Apart from a top few teams each year, the others are just punchbag sparring partners, doomed to lose except when they play each other – and always on the edge of bankruptcy. The Premier League says it is the world's top competition. In terms of the money it generates, much of it from the fans and most of it going outside the sport and the country, it is the tops. In terms of quality football, it isn't. A Premier League team has won the top European competition only four times in the 21 years since the league was formed. Premier League matches are usually – apart from the hype – dull. What we saw in the World Cup was a different game.
The top European players, including Gareth Bale, do not play in the Premier League. All but a few of the foreign players in the Premier League are second-rate yet paid enormous salaries. Many are in their late twenties and starting to coast. To call the Premier League "English" may be an offence under the Trade Descriptions Act. The only way to win the league is to get a sugar daddy from abroad to buy your club, a manager and most of "your" team, all from abroad. (Last season only 25% of the players in the Premier League were qualified to play for England.) We'll never win the World Cup again and we'll only rarely win in Europe. Who are the winners in our national game?
Geoff Scargill
Stockport, Cheshire

[1] Why does the Premiership need more than 50 English players?
[2] The sole purpose behind having Premiership English footballers to is produce players for the England squad
[3] Given the quality of the Premiership, it is delusional to expect it to produce more than say 40 genuine English players
[4] I disagree with the notion that the Premiership is a crap league. It is one of the best in the world
[5] I believe the English Premiership has a collection of some of the world's best players
[6] For me, the Premiership is an international league that just happens to be based in England, kind of like the way the UN building is based in New York
[7] Most of the Premiership players, managers, club owners and above all fans are from outside England. It is the sale of TV rights internationally that generates most of its money
[8] Some old school people want to hark back to the days when the league was all English but those days have long gone
[9] The law of averages will always dictate that with a population of just 50m, there is only so many Premiership players England can produce
[10] Some little Englanders are just harking to the golden age that never was. They will be washed aside by the tide of history!
